Calculate Log Base 380 of 338

To solve the equation log 380 (338)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 338, a = 380:
    log 380 (338) = log(338) / log(380)
  3. Evaluate the term:
    log(338) / log(380)
    = 1.39794000867204 / 1.92427928606188
    = 0.98028249485505
    = Logarithm of 338 with base 380
